Why Press Release Headlines are So Important?

Headlines are the first thing a reader checks before reading any content. A headline is what helps to understand what the story is all about and allows having a better idea and judgment towards the authenticity of the content. Online readers are fairly impatient and to retain them on your content, you need to create an attractive headline that makes them stay and make read the whole content.

When it comes to readers and target audiences, it is not just the customers but you need the attention of journalists, marketers, and investors as well. As they go through a lot of PR content every day; they must skim-read and get an overall idea of the story. Therefore, you need to create a headline that instantly grabs their attention. Only when the title is capable of appealing the readers from niche and various other industries; does the press release become a successful tool for distribution. If you are not sure how a PR headline becomes attractive, here are some tips.

  • Keep it short and easy to read (not more than 70-80 characters with spaces)
  • Keep it relevant, attractive, and engaging
  • The title must share a solution to a problem or fulfill a need for customers 
  • The title must include a high-search volume keyword for SEO

How to Use Google to Craft Press Release Headlines?

Google is the biggest and most used browser or search engine worldwide. Utilizing it to craft press release headlines is a wise choice to perform well in search results that are biased to Google Search Engine guidelines and algorithms. Go through the following steps to craft your PR title with the help of Google.

1. Keyword Research

It starts with keyword research on the browser that allows finding the words which most used by online users when looking for things to buy to learn about. It is the initial step of SEO as well as writing a title as the keyword will be incorporated in the title later. Google is a choice in this case as comes with a handful of built-in features that offer more ease and convenience in the process.

2. Keyword Planner

Google Keyword Planner is a tool that helps to find proper keywords for Google ad campaigns. However, just because it is built for the purpose of ad campaigns, does not mean you can use it for writing the press release title. It is an all-in-one powerful for keyword generation and identification which are performing exponentially well in the respective market. Once you have identified the right keywords for your brand, it is time to utilize them in your content marketing approaches including press release distribution services.

3. Google Trends

It is a highly advanced tool that offers real-time data in order to analyze Google search terms based on their popularity. Trending topics are excellent for immediate PR distributions which can garner more attention from online users. Such content prompts make your PR relevant, powerful, and highly time-sensitive. The PR might not offer long-lasting results and market trends are constantly evolving. However, it can quickly generate buzz and offer instant exposure in the market as well as in niche industries.

In order to get started, discover trending news stories and click on the tab called "Trending Now". Look for a news story that is relevant to your brand and industry. Can the topic pique interest among potential customers? If yes, then make sure to use that in your campaign which makes your content more trendy.

4. Explore the Search Engine Result Pages (SERPs)

The SERPs that appear after submitting a search query can help you gain more inspiration for writing the PR title. The SERPs are ranked from page to page and the content that appears on the first page is the most read one. You need to do research on the search engine and check the first page to understand what kind of titles are performing well. In case you have a particular topic or keyword in mind, simply search it on Google and take a better look at the content that appears on the first page. Study their headlines and question yourself,

  • What kind of words they are using on the headline?
  • How the headlines are that appear on the top?
  • How many keywords are being used in a single PR?
  • Does the title express some solution to a problem?

Finding the answers to these questions can help you understand where your PR title is lacking. PR is newsworthy content and its title must be accurate and attractive enough to gain maximum media coverage from the market. Use the information to create a press release headline of your own.

5. ‘Searches related to’ Section

Wen, you are utilizing search engines, you will find a “Searches related to” section at the bottom of the page. Scroll down and simply click on it. The section will offer you a handful of keyword variations that you can utilize to craft the perfect headline for your press release content. This section helps to find what is most relevant without making it repetitive.

6. Autocomplete

Google’s search engine also provides a feature for ‘autocomplete’ to provide relevant suggestions. If you look closely, when you start typing in the search bar; Google starts providing relevant suggestions in the drop-down menu. Those suggestions are mainly provided based on the popular search results regarding your topic. Keep an eye on these suggestive phrases and keywords as an inspiration for writing the PR headlines.
